Environmental Issues Are Political Issues

After playing defense on the environment for more than a decade, the results of the 2006 elections have created an opportunity to make real progress. It's time to combat global warming, increase clean, renewable energy and energy efficiency, and protect our natural heritage and public health. LCV is working on these and other important issues and will be making sure that our elected officials take action to protect the environment.

  • The Dirty Dozen
    LCV's trademark Dirty Dozen program targets members of Congress, regardless of party affiliation, who consistently vote against the environment and are up for re-election in races where we have a serious chance to affect the outcome. Check out the 2008 Dirty Dozen.
